Juneau vs Whitehorse: which is sunnier?
🇺🇸 United States vs 🇨🇦 Canada · 263 km apart · long-term climate normals (NASA POWER, 2001–2020)
Whitehorse is the sunnier overall: about 1,919 hours of sunshine a year to Juneau's 1,229. Whitehorse has the higher Sunshine Score in 4 of 12 months, Juneau in 1 (7 within 2 points).
Scores are the 0–100 Sunshine Score — sunshine, daytime warmth and dryness in one number, per month.

At a glance
| Juneau | Whitehorse | |
|---|---|---|
| Sunshine hours / year | 1,229 | 1,919 |
| Sunniest month | July (39/100) | July (64/100) |
| Nov–Feb average score | 0/100 | 0/100 |
| Jun–Aug average score | 36/100 | 58/100 |
| Rain / year | 3,155 mm | 581 mm |
| Peak midday UV | 3 (moderate) | 4 (moderate) |
Juneau vs Whitehorse month by month
| Month | Sunshine Score | Day high °C | Rain mm |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Juneau | Whitehorse | Juneau | Whitehorse | Juneau | Whitehorse | |
| January | 0 | 0 | -1° | -10° | 339 | 42 |
| February | 0 | 0 | 0° | -8° | 221 | 27 |
| March | 0 | 0 | 1° | -5° | 209 | 31 |
| April | 0 | 0 | 5° | 2° | 173 | 28 |
| May | 5 | 21 | 9° | 11° | 154 | 39 |
| June | 29 | 51 | 14° | 16° | 148 | 70 |
| July | 39 | 64 | 16° | 18° | 204 | 73 |
| August | 39 | 58 | 16° | 17° | 280 | 70 |
| September | 24 | 13 | 13° | 10° | 369 | 61 |
| October | 0 | 0 | 7° | 3° | 384 | 57 |
| November | 0 | 0 | 1° | -7° | 329 | 42 |
| December | 0 | 0 | -1° | -10° | 345 | 41 |
The sunnier month by month: Jan even · Feb even · Mar even · Apr even · May Whitehorse · Jun Whitehorse · Jul Whitehorse · Aug Whitehorse · Sep Juneau · Oct even · Nov even · Dec even.
When to pick which
- November–February: too close to call — Juneau averages 0/100, Whitehorse 0/100. Juneau is the warmer, around 0°C daytime highs vs -9°C. See the winter sun ranking.
- March–May: Whitehorse (average score 7/100 vs 2). Juneau is the warmer, around 5°C daytime highs vs 3°C.
- June–August: Whitehorse (average score 58/100 vs 36). Whitehorse is the warmer, around 17°C daytime highs vs 15°C.
- September–October: Juneau (average score 12/100 vs 7). Juneau is the warmer, around 10°C daytime highs vs 7°C.
